- verbthwack (verb) · thwacks (third person present) · thwacked (past tense) · thwacked (past participle) · thwacking (present participle)
- strike forcefully with a sharp blow:"she thwacked the back of their knees with a cane"
nounthwack (noun) · thwacks (plural noun)- a sharp blow:"he hit it with a hefty thwack"
Originlate Middle English: imitative.Similar and Opposite Words
